NFL Preseason Week 2 Odds: Cutler Debut for Dolphins Among Betting Matchups

Jay Cutler is expected to make his debut for the Miami Dolphins on Thursday, when they host the Baltimore Ravens to kick off Week 2 of the NFL preseason schedule.

The former Chicago Bears quarterback will start, according to Miami head coach Adam Gase, with the Dolphins sitting as 3-point betting favorites at sportsbooks monitored by OddsShark.

Cutler was retired before deciding to reunite with Gase, his offensive coordinator in Chicago during the 2015 season when he posted the highest QB rating of his career (92.3). His services were needed when Ryan Tannehill suffered a season-ending knee injury during training camp.
